开发者社区 问答 正文

万亿级数据洪峰下的消息引擎——Apache RocketMQ

阿里巴巴高级技术专家 王小瑞(誓嘉)在QCon上做了主题为《万亿级数据洪峰下的消息引擎——Apache RocketMQ》的演讲,就阿里消息中间件演变历史,双11万亿级数据洪峰挑战和Apache RocketMQ未来展望等进行了深入的分享。

https://yq.aliyun.com/download/686?spm=a2c4e.11154804.0.0.7df66a799bHsoo

展开
收起
福利达人 2018-06-18 12:09:41 1156 分享 版权
阿里云 AI 助理回答

在阿里巴巴高级技术专家王小瑞(誓嘉)的QCon演讲《万亿级数据洪峰下的消息引擎——Apache RocketMQ》中,虽然直接的知识库内容没有涵盖演讲的具体细节,但我们可以根据现有资料概述几个关键点,这些点可能与演讲内容紧密相关:

  1. 阿里消息中间件的演变历史

    • 未直接提供具体演变历程,但可以推测RocketMQ作为阿里自研的消息中间件,在设计之初就考虑了大规模分布式系统的需求,经历了从满足内部业务需求到开源并成为Apache顶级项目的历程。它的发展反映了对高吞吐、低延迟、高可用性等核心特性的不断追求和完善。
  2. 双11万亿级数据洪峰挑战

    • 面对双11这样的极端流量场景,RocketMQ展现了其处理能力。通过**消费者分组(ConsumerGroup)**实现消费逻辑和配置的一致性,确保消息被水平扩展的消费者有效处理。异步通信模型帮助系统解耦,实现容量削峰填谷,应对瞬时流量高峰。
    • 消息存储和清理机制确保即使在大量消息堆积的情况下,也能通过云原生自研存储系统按需扩展存储空间,避免因存储限制影响服务稳定性。
  3. Apache RocketMQ未来展望

    • 从推荐使用gRPC协议SDK可以看出,RocketMQ正朝着提供更高性能和更优使用体验的方向发展,特别是对于新接入系统的用户。
    • 对于定时和延时消息的支持,阿里云RocketMQ版不仅提供了比社区版更精细的时间控制(秒级)和更高的并发处理能力,还简化了配置过程,体现了其在功能丰富性和易用性上的持续优化。

综上所述,尽管知识库未直接转述演讲内容,但结合RocketMQ的核心特性、架构优势及其在阿里巴巴集团内部及云产品中的应用实践,可以推断王小瑞的演讲重点讨论了RocketMQ如何通过技术创新和架构设计来应对超大规模数据处理的挑战,以及其对未来消息中间件领域发展的潜在影响。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答